| Question | Answer |
| What does the locate command use? | a Database |
| Who can update the locate database? | an administrator |
| What command is use to update the locate database? | updatedb command |
| What command does a regular user needs to use to update the database? | su -c command |
| Command to search for files currently in the filesystem: | find command |
| What is the first argument that the find command expects? | a directory |
| What can the whereis command search for? | PATH for the binary |
| How to find the real bash result for a command? | Use which command |
| What does the type command do? | determine information about various commands |
| For security reasons, the FHS divides files based on 2 criteria: | Shareable / Unshareable and Variable / Static |
| What does the FHS stand for? | Filesystem Hierarchy Standard |
